2016 Chevrolet Colorado Powertrain

The 2016 Chevrolet Colorado is available with three engines, two transmissions, and two rear axles. In addition, the pickup truck is available in either rear-wheel-drive or all-wheel-drive.

Engines

The 2016 Colorado is offered with three engine choices, two that run on gasoline and one that runs on diesel:

  • 2.5L I-4 LCV gasoline engine is rated at 200 horsepower (149 kW) and 191 pound-feet of torque (259 Nm)
  • 3.6L V-6 LFX gasoline engine is rated at 305 horsepower (227 kW) and 269 pound-feet of torque (365 Nm)
  • 2.8L Duramax LWN Turbo-Diesel is SAE-certified at 181 horsepower (135 kW) at 3,400 rpm and 369 pound-feet of torque (500 Nm) at 2,000 rpm

Transmissions

The 2016 Colorado offers two six-speed transmissions:

  • Hydra-Matic 6-speed automatic 6L50 HMD
  • Eaton 6-speed manual N8D

Axles

The 2016 Chevy Colorado is available with two rear axles:

  1. 4.10 ratio GT5
  2. 3.42 ratio GU6

2WD & 4WD

The 2016 Chevrolet Colorado is offered in both 2WD and 4WD configurations.
